Notes: Tape flip during last verse of d01t07; flip cuts off sustained bass note ending d02t02. No noise reduction or expansion. Recorded on a Hitachi 290, using the microphone from the RCA YLS 15B portable reel to reel recorder. Original cassettes were transferred to a Mac DAW using a Nakamichi 480. The analog signal was first run through a SAE 2800 parametric equalizer to bump the highs slightly. Lo Cut filter on Mackie 1402-VLZ used to remove grunge below 75 Hz (-18 db/octive). Transferred to the Mac using a MOTU 896/Bias Peak. Bias Deck used to splice tape flips & even out volume levels. Bias Peak again used to transfer SDII files to WAV files for shn compression. xACT used to fix SBEs & encode to SHNs. This recording is one of literally dozens of concerts recorded by Joe Maloney in the late '60s - late '70s to be released to the live recording community. The bulk of the concerts recorded were in the Boston area, with some in Maine venues.

Notes: Incredible story in the info file about the audience going nuts and crowding the main floor during the performance. It seems the band had to cut the show short. When tickets for their 1975 tour went on sale in January, the box office opened the Garden to allow the line of fans to stay warm inside while waiting for tickets . Once inside, they went nuts, causing $25K in damage & the promoters cancelled the show. This 1973 concert would be the last time Zeppelin played Boston.
